Lukas Toenne
a90b8ebe48 Fix for crash from double-freeing in nodes:
The way node groups check for localized trees in the ntreeFreeTree_ex function does not work. When the main library is freed on exit it also frees genuine node groups trees (which is correct), but then
node groups referencing these trees will not find them in the library and interpret that as a localized group, attempting to free them a second time ... Nicer solution is to just use a special flag on
localized node trees so we can clearly distinguish them from genuine trees in main.

Lukas Toenne
77a0b90cdf Cleanup: Consistent names for draw callbacks in bNodeType.
This aims to establish a common pattern for the various confusing draw callback function pointers in bNodeType:

draw_<purpose>_<nodetype>[_ex]

Currently there are 4 different types of draw callbacks:
* draw_nodetype, draw_nodetype_prepare: Main draw functions, allows specialized node drawing for things like frames and reroute nodes. Not exposed in the API.
* draw_buttons, draw_buttons_ex: Optional non-socket buttons, most commonly used callback. Extended version used in sidebar for verbose buttons that don't fit into a node.
* draw_backdrop: Draw elements in the backdrop (compositor only). Not exposed in the API.
* draw_input, draw_output: Specialized socket drawing for some nodes, only for OutputFile node. Should not be used any further and be removed at some point. Not exposed in the API.

Dalai Felinto
4abb8fde95 Photoshop PSD support
We now support the combined layer of Photoshop files (stored as layer 0
in the file). This way users can keep their files as multilayer PSD and
Blender always handle them as flat images.

For perfect alpha this requires an OpenImageIO update:
342cc2633f

Photoshop sample files:
https://github.com/OpenImageIO/oiio-images

Brecht has some pending fixes to push for OIIO as well, so we may as
well wait to update our libraries.

What works:
===========
* 8bit images (with or without alpha)
* 16bits images (alpha discarded)
* Photoshop files saved with 'Maximum Compatibility'
* Cycles, Blender internal,  BGE (and player)

Known limitations
(due to OIIO dependency):
=========================
* Images with less than 4 channels show a wrong thumbnail (bug may be in  OIIO)
* Packed images are not supported
* We do not write PSD files.

Note: old Blenders have support for PSD via Quicktime library. But due
to license issues this was discontinued.

Many thanks for Brecht van Lommel for reviewing the patch, suggesting
multiple improvements and to help solving the alpha issue.

Lukas Toenne
31433a3809 Fix #36981, Removing Sample line fails during render.
The SAMPLELINE flag in histogram was set during the BKE_histogram_update_sample_line function. That function in turn is called during every scope update in area draw function, meaning that during render
it constantly gets set. OTOH the operator tries to disable the flag on invoke, which "cancels" the sample line by default. So during render the operator un-setting of the flag has no effect, because the
render job immediatly triggers a redraw, which updates scopes and sets it again.

Moved the flag out of the actual sample line update function into the operator execute. Now only the operator enables/disables overall sample line drawing, while the rest of the update works as before.

Brecht Van Lommel
cdb8736f83 Fix #36930: dynamic topology sculpting with masks gave bad results:
* The mask was not subdivided properly on splitting edges, which gave interesting
  but definitely wrong fractal-like borders around masks.

* Edge splitting was only done where the mask was < 50%, with the reasoning that
  you can't do a 50% topology update. But this gives an ugly border in the mesh.
  The mask should already make the brush move the vertices only 50%, which means
  that topology updates will also happen less frequent, that should be enough.
